Objective1. To observe the expression of c-Met and CD105in the tissue of serous lesions in epithelial ovary2. To investigate the relation between clinicopathologic features in serous epithelial ovarian carcinomas and the expression of c-Met and CD105and explore the effects of c-Met and CD105on the meaning of development, invasion and metastasis of serous epithelial ovarian carcinomas;3. To study the relation between c-Met and angiogenesis of serous epithelial ovarian carcinomas in behaving of CD105MVD, to provide the new target of the treatment and prognosis of serous ovarian carcinomas.Methods Ninety-five tissues embedded by paraffin were studied which surgically excised in Tianjin central gynecology and obstetric hospital from January in2010to January in2011, including twenty-eight cases of high-grade serous epithelial ovarian adenocarcinomas, twenty-one cases of low-grade serous epithelial ovarian adenocarcinomas,twenty-five cases of borderline serous epithelial ovarian adenomas, twenty-one cases of benigh serous epithelial ovarian adenomas. Their clinical data were collected including age, histological types, FIGO stages, peritoneal cytology, pelvic or para-aortic lymph node metastasis, size of residual cancer, the immunochemistry expression of p53in serous ovarian adenocarcinomas, the level of serum cancer antigen125(CA125), carbohydrate ntigen CA19-9(CA19-9) and human epididymal epididymis protein4(HE4) before surgery. The immunohistochemistry method was applied to determine the expression of c-Met and CD105.Results1. The positive rates of high-grade serous ovarian caicinomas, low-grade serous ovarian carcinomas, serous borderline epithelial ovarian adenomas and benigh serous epithelial ovarian adenomas were39.3%,76.2%,56.0%,52.4%; There was statistical difference among the positive expression of c-Met in low-grade and high-grade serous ovarian carcinoma(P<0.01). There was no defference between low-grade serous carcinomas and benigh and borderline adenomas(P>0.05); There was no defference between high-grade serous ovarian carcinoma and benigh and borderline serous ovarian adenomas(P>0.05); The mean level of CD105MVD in high-grade serous epithelial ovarian carcinomas, low-grade serous carcinomas, borderline serous ovarian adenomas, benigh serous ovarian adenomas were12.9±4.7,5.4±1.5,3.8±2.0,1.0±1.3;There was significant difference between high-grade serous ovarian carcinoas and other three ones(P<0.01); There were statistical difference between low-grade serous ovarian carninomas and benigh ones(P<0.01), There was no defference between low-grade serous ovarian carcinoma and borderline serous ovarian adenomas(P>0.05); There were statistical difference between borderline serous ovarian adenomas and benigh ones(P<0.01).2. There were statistical difference of c-Met in peritoneal cytology of serous ovarian carcinomas(P<0.05); There were statistical differences of CD105MVD in the different FIGO stages, histological types, pelvic or para-aortic lymph node metastasis, size of residual cancer, and the level of serum HE4before surgery in serous ovarian carcinomas(.P<0.05).3. There was no relevance between c-Met and CD105MVD (P>0.05).Conclusions1. The positive expression of c-Met in serous ovarian leision correlates with hyperplastic activity regardless of atypical degree of tumor cells:The positive rate of c-Met is higher in negative peritoneal cytology than in positive one; The positive expression of CD105MVD in serous ovarian lesion gradually increases with the malignant transformation of tumor cells. The positive expression of CD105corelates with FIGO stage, histological type, lymph node metastasis and size of residual cancer. They may involve in the occurrence, development and metastasis of serous ovarian carcinomas.2. There is no correlation between c-Met and CD105implicating other factors may involve in cancer angiogenesis.
